the one i have has twin vcarbs, the two 3ascv have only one, the exaust one is a 421 type mani, now to the naked eye the cams are the same, ill try to put them on the lathe and see if there is any diference in the lift, duration i dont know how could i meassure it, also i checked the intake ports on both heads, and on the su engine the ports are a lot more squared shape than the stock one, tday i starte the port and polish part, once i get some money 3 or 5 angle job and shave the ell out of the head 10:1 i hope
